Google just released a media server gadget which enables UPnP sharing to your DLNA devices … things like your PS3 and XBox as reported by Crunchgear. I’m thinking this is actually far more about mobile then set top box though that’s likely to be both a source of content and a display end point.

Given what Nokia has cooking with Home Sync, the rumored iPhone wifi sync and AppleTV, this year is looking good for consumers to get a handle on media – both at home and on the go.

The iPhone definitely stepped up the bar for device sync and I’m looking forward to seeing where this all nets out. Anything that makes it easier to sync content to and from your mobile device as well as within a home network is a good thing in my book. The more functions we cram into things the easier it is for them to become islands and the main reason capture and create media really is to share.
